M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
investigates
topics
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
gains in
distance learning technology have provided the means for
people
all over the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
generally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
topics that
e-learning institutions
are having to consider
today because blended learning technology is
developing so rapidly.
MOOCs support interactions between students and professors with user forums and other forms of online communities.
